All Golf course

Badplaas Golf Club, Guest House & Lodge

 

Devonvale Golf & Wine Estate

 

Eshowe Hills Eco & Golf Estate

 

Little Eden Guest House

 

Pebble Rock Golf & Country Club

 

Pebble Rock Golf and Bushveld Estate